At Kirov on Vyatka the large 90 meter hill with its impressive steel structure was built in 1951 and was at that time one of Europe's largest hills. Many national competitions had been hosted there over the years and with Dmitry Kochkin, Alexei Borovitin or Vyacheslav Dryagin a few top ski jumpers were promoted.
Education of young ski jumpers is still important in Kirov and thus a fundamental modernization of the ski jumps is planned.
